Does anyone know if you can find the mainspring strain screw at a local hardware or Fastenal store? I don't want to mess up the original but want to start to work on finding the perfect/consistent firing light trigger pull. I have a Wolff hammer spring and 11# trigger return spring installed. Just looking for a little more.

What I use on all my S&W revolvers is a 1/2 inch long 8/32 screw with an allen head. I apply blue loctite to the threads so it stays were I set it but it is easily adjusted. I have one on all 6 of my S&W revolvers and it works great.
